當(dāng)我們使用el-cascader組件時(shí),有時(shí)后臺(tái)返回的數(shù)據(jù)和我們組件對(duì)應(yīng)的值不一樣,很多人會(huì)選擇把后臺(tái)返回的值給循環(huán)遍歷處理一遍,把值改成value、label、children,但是實(shí)際不必如果。通過props屬性輕松配置,話不多說,直接上代碼:
后臺(tái)返回的數(shù)據(jù):
[{
id: '1',
name: '指南',
child: [{
id: 'shejiyuanze',
name: '設(shè)計(jì)原則',
child: [{
id: 'yizhi',
name: '一致'
}]
}]
vue文件
<el-cascader< p="">
:options="cityList"
:props="{ value: 'id',label: 'name',children: 'child'}"
v-model="selectedOptions"
@change="handleChange">
ok,是不是超級(jí)簡單。如果看不懂的寶寶,你要細(xì)品。
文章來源:田珊珊個(gè)人博客
來源地址:http://www.tianshan277.com/835.html
申請(qǐng)創(chuàng)業(yè)報(bào)道,分享創(chuàng)業(yè)好點(diǎn)子。點(diǎn)擊此處,共同探討創(chuàng)業(yè)新機(jī)遇!